They were showing the clips where Gul was starting to bowl that over, Asif handed over the ball to him, and Hair was observing all that as he and other umpire should do after every over. There isn't any recorded footage available which would provide any evidence of ball tampering. Botham basically said umpires seems to have no visual evidence of any deliberate change in the state of the ball, unless they are simply assuming that it happened. And in that case they have a very weak case.

They also acknowledged the way Inzi dealt with the siutation as any other captain could have taken the team off the field.

Sky team did point out Hair looking closely at Asif shinnign the ball as Gul was walking back to his run up.

He might have noticed a change in the condition of the ball after that over, but fortunately for Pakistan, Asif did everything ON HIS WATCH, and REGARDLESS of how different the ball might have become after that over, Hair cannot attribute it to anything Asif did unless he clearly saw something. The cameras didn't, and it would be pretty stupid of Asif to do anything naughty while Hair was clearly watching him closely.

So I think it's another case of Hair 'prejudging' us under the presumption that 'we are cheats' and attributing the change in condition of the ball to our tampering of it.
